Qatar told the UN Security Council that it would not tolerate “reckless” Israeli behaviour, after Israel carried out a strike in Doha aimed at senior Hamas officials. “This Tuesday afternoon … an Israeli attack targeted residential buildings housing several members of the political bureau of Hamas in the Qatari capital, Doha,” Qatar’s mission said in a letter seen by The National to the 15-member body. Qatar said the strike posed “a serious threat to the security and safety of Qataris and residents”, and violated international law.
